About the role
Mechanical Engineer
Synectics Inc. is seeking a Mechanical Engineer with 4-8 years of experience to join our team. This role involves preparing specifications for mechanical equipment, estimating costs, and providing technical support for generation projects.
Responsibilities:
- Prepare specifications for purchases of mechanical equipment and materials.
- Estimate material, labor, or construction costs for budget preparation.
- Write reports and compile data on mechanical engineering projects and studies.
- Provide technical support to other departments and personnel.
- Ensure compliance with specifications, codes, or customer requirements.
- Direct or coordinate installation, manufacturing, construction, maintenance, documentation, support, or testing activities.
- Establish construction, manufacturing, or installation standards or specifications.
- Perform a wide range of detailed calculations.
- Evaluate and review mechanical equipment and piping size and layouts.
- Conduct construction drawing reviews of P&ID and equipment layouts.
- Collaborate with customers and coworkers on mechanical engineering products or projects.
- Monitor project progress and budget, and prepare reports for upper management.
- Conduct equipment drawing and vendor submittal reviews.
- Design, maintain, implement, or improve mechanical instruments, facilities, components, equipment products, or systems.
- Serve as the primary point of contact with clients for mechanical engineering project matters.
- Manage the development and implementation of mechanical systems.
- Complete site visits as necessary to support engineering and construction.
Qualifications:
- Bachelor's degree in mechanical, welding, or industrial engineering from an ABET accredited program; OR Engineering degree from a non-ABET accredited program + a Professional Engineering license in Mechanical Engineering.
- 4 - 8 years of experience.
- Analytical and problem-solving skills.
- Mechanical and technical skills.
- Written and verbal communication skills.
- Organizational skills and attention to detail.
- Experience with the design and specification of power generation fluid systems (steam, condensate, fuel gas, cooling water, compressed air, etc.), especially in natural gas plants.
- Proficient in MS Office, with aptitude for learning new software.
- Strong P&ID and equipment layout review skills.
- Experience in mechanical system design & drawing interpretation.
- Heavy industrial, utilities, or power plant experience.
- Familiarity with pumps, fans, boilers, welding, conveyor systems, etc.
